single malt cask investment involves purchasing a cask of whisky and holding onto it for a period of time in order to allow it to mature. This process can take years, during which time the whisky will increase in value due to factors such as scarcity, quality, and demand.
There are several advantages to investing in single malt casks. Here are a few reasons why this type of investment is worth considering:
1. Potential for High Returns: One of the biggest advantages of investing in single malt casks is the potential for high returns. Whisky prices have been steadily increasing in recent years, with some bottles selling for tens of thousands of dollars. By investing in a cask, you have the opportunity to see significant returns on your initial investment over time.
2. Tangible Asset: Unlike some other investment options, such as stocks or bonds, a single malt cask is a tangible asset that you can physically see and touch. This can provide a sense of security and stability, as you have direct control over your investment.
3. Low Correlation to Traditional Markets: single malt cask investment is not directly correlated to traditional financial markets, such as stocks and bonds. This means that it can provide diversification to your investment portfolio, helping to reduce overall risk.
4. Increasing Demand: The demand for single malt whisky has been steadily increasing in recent years, especially in emerging markets such as China and India. This increasing demand is driving up prices and making single malt cask investment even more lucrative.
5. Limited Supply: Single malt casks are a finite resource, with each cask producing only a limited number of bottles. As a result, the supply of aged whisky is limited, which can drive up its value over time.
6. Enjoyment: Investing in single malt casks not only provides the potential for financial gains but also allows you to enjoy the process of watching your investment mature. Many investors take pleasure in sampling their whisky as it ages, adding a unique dimension to their investment experience.
Of course, like any investment, there are also risks associated with single malt cask investment. Whisky prices can be volatile, depending on factors such as market trends, production levels, and changes in consumer preferences. Furthermore, there are costs associated with storing and maintaining a cask, as well as potential risks such as leakage or spoilage.
